Measuring Your Child’s Feet
Start by measuring your child’s feet. Use a ruler or a measuring tape. Have your child stand on a piece of paper. Trace around each foot. Measure from the heel to the longest toe. Note the measurement in inches or centimeters. Ensure you measure both feet. One foot might be slightly larger. Use the larger measurement for sizing.
Understanding Shoe Sizes
Shoe sizes can be confusing. Different brands use different sizing charts. Compare your measurements with the shoe brand’s size chart. Look for the corresponding shoe size. Consider the type of socks your child will wear. Thicker socks may require a slightly larger size. Always check for a little room at the toe. This allows for growth and comfort. Cleaning And Care
Remove dirt and debris after each game. Use a soft brush to scrub off mud and grass. Avoid soaking the shoes in water. Instead, use a damp cloth to wipe them clean. For stubborn stains, mix mild soap with water. Gently scrub the affected areas. Rinse with a damp cloth and let them air dry.
Check the soles for pebbles or other debris. Use a toothpick or a small tool to remove them. This prevents damage to the turf and prolongs the life of your shoes.
Storage Advice
Store your turf shoes in a cool, dry place. Avoid leaving them in direct sunlight or damp areas. Excessive heat or moisture can damage the materials.
Use a shoe rack or shelf to keep them organized. This helps maintain their shape and prevents accidental damage. If you have shoe inserts, use them to help the shoes retain their form.
Allow the shoes to air out after each use. Remove the insoles and let them dry separately. This reduces odor and keeps the shoes fresh.

Ignoring The Fit
A common mistake is ignoring the fit of the turf shoes. Shoes that are too tight can cause discomfort and blisters. On the other hand, shoes that are too loose can lead to instability and even injury. Always ensure the shoes fit snugly but comfortably.
Here are some tips to find the right fit:
- Measure feet at the end of the day when they are largest.
- Allow a thumb’s width of space between the big toe and the shoe’s end.
- Check the width; shoes should not pinch the sides of the feet.

How Do Turf Shoes Differ From Cleats?
Turf shoes have rubber outsoles with small, dense studs. Cleats have longer, metal or plastic spikes. Turf shoes are ideal for artificial surfaces, while cleats are better for grass fields.
